About the Lorex Sweet Peek video Baby Monitor:
- 2.4″ Portable LCD Monitor
- Crystal Clear Night Vision
- Digital Zoom
- Two-Way Talk
- Soothing Lullabies
- Built-In Nightlight
- Crisp Sound
- 450 ft Outdoor Wireless Range
- Accommodates up to 4 Cameras
- Up to 8 Hours of Battery Life
My Thoughts:
Technology is my best friend. No matter what age your children are these are a must have! For about the first week I had these I moved the monitor back and forth between the kids room. My six-year-old likes to wake up in the middle of the night and watch his T.V. So one night he got a nice little surprise when he heard his mom (but couldn’t see her) to turn off his T.V. and go back to bed!! So, honestly I would have to say my favorite feature is the two-way talk. It’s so funny to watch the kids reaction the first time they heard me. There are so many more great features this video monitor. I only have one camera, but you are able to connect more than one camera and connect it to one monitor. I plan to get another camera or two after we move. You are also able to zoom in on the scream. Which is perfect! One day I couldn’t notice were Carly Jo was in the crib. (She recently made her first big escape from the crib, so I thought she did it again.) But before I went in to check I zoomed in on her crib and spotted her in the furthest corner of her crib! So I was able to relax knowing she was sleeping in her bed. We recently started turning on our air conditioner. I am always afraid they are too cold or hot, so it’s nice that the these baby monitors will tell me what temp it is in their room. That way I can adjust it accordingly and not have to guess. With it being summer time my family and I like going outside and setting a fire in the fire pit. However, sometimes it pasts Carly Jo’s bed time. I use to have run in and out to check on her because I couldn’t see or hear her. The monitor is portable, so I am able to take it outside with me and see her (even in the dark, the night vision is PERFECT!) and hear her just as I was in the house. My oldest daughter who is afraid of the dark loves the fact that it has a night-light on it. Carly Jo’s favorite part is that it will play music for her until she falls a sleep. I can’t tell how much I love this monitor. It makes resting at night-time a whole lot easier!!!
